ソラナ(SOL)を利用した分散型アプリケーション最新動向
はじめに
ブロックチェーン技術の進化は、金融、サプライチェーン、ゲーム、そしてソーシャルメディアに至るまで、様々な分野に変革をもたらしています。その中でも、ソラナ(Solana)は、高いスループットと低い手数料を特徴とする高性能ブロックチェーンとして注目を集めています。本稿では、ソラナを利用した分散型アプリケーション(DApps)の最新動向について、技術的な側面、主要なプロジェクト、そして今後の展望を詳細に解説します。
ソラナの技術的特徴
ソラナが他のブロックチェーンと一線を画すのは、その独自の技術アーキテクチャにあります。特に重要な要素は以下の通りです。
- Proof of History (PoH):従来のProof of Work (PoW)やProof of Stake (PoS)とは異なり、PoHはトランザクションの発生順序を暗号学的に証明する仕組みです。これにより、ネットワーク全体の合意形成プロセスを大幅に高速化し、高いスループットを実現しています。
- Tower BFT:PoHと組み合わせることで、より効率的な合意形成を可能にする、ソラナ独自の耐障害性のあるBFT(Byzantine Fault Tolerance)コンセンサスアルゴリズムです。
- Turbine:ブロック伝播プロトコルであり、ネットワーク全体へのブロックの迅速な伝達を可能にします。
- Gulf Stream:トランザクションのフォワーディングプロトコルであり、トランザクションの遅延を最小限に抑えます。
- Sealevel:並列処理エンジンであり、スマートコントラクトの実行を高速化します。
これらの技術的特徴により、ソラナは理論上、毎秒数千トランザクションを処理できる能力を持ち、VisaやMastercardといった既存の決済システムに匹敵するパフォーマンスを実現しています。また、トランザクション手数料が非常に低いため、マイクロペイメントや頻繁なトランザクションを伴うアプリケーションに適しています。
ソラナにおけるDAppsのカテゴリー
ソラナ上で開発されているDAppsは、多岐にわたります。主なカテゴリーとしては、以下のものが挙げられます。
- DeFi (分散型金融):ソラナは、DEX(分散型取引所)、レンディングプラットフォーム、ステーブルコインなど、様々なDeFiアプリケーションの基盤として利用されています。
- NFT (非代替性トークン):アート、ゲームアイテム、コレクティブルなど、様々なNFTプロジェクトがソラナ上で展開されています。
- ゲーム:ソラナの高速性と低手数料は、ブロックチェーンゲームの開発に適しており、多くのゲームプロジェクトがソラナを採用しています。
- Web3インフラ:ウォレット、ブリッジ、データストレージなど、Web3エコシステムを支えるインフラストラクチャもソラナ上で開発されています。
- ソーシャルメディア:分散型のソーシャルメディアプラットフォームもソラナ上で登場しており、検閲耐性やプライバシー保護といったメリットを提供しています。
主要なソラナDAppsプロジェクト
ソラナ上で注目を集めている主要なDAppsプロジェクトをいくつか紹介します。
- Raydium:ソラナ上で最も人気のあるDEXの一つであり、AMM(自動マーケットメーカー)とオーダーブックの両方の機能を備えています。
- Serum:ソラナ上で構築されたオーダーブックDEXであり、高いスループットと低い手数料を実現しています。
- Marinade Finance:ソラナのネイティブトークンであるSOLのステーキングプラットフォームであり、流動性ステーキングトークン(mSOL)を提供しています。
- Magic Eden:ソラナ上で最も人気のあるNFTマーケットプレイスであり、幅広いNFTコレクションを取り扱っています。
- Star Atlas:ソラナ上で構築された大規模なメタバースゲームであり、宇宙探査と戦略的なゲームプレイを提供しています。
- Audius:分散型の音楽ストリーミングプラットフォームであり、アーティストが直接ファンとつながり、収益を得ることを可能にします。
- Solend:ソラナ上のレンディングプロトコルであり、SOLやその他のトークンを貸し借りすることができます。
これらのプロジェクトは、ソラナの技術的優位性を活かし、革新的なサービスを提供しています。また、ソラナのエコシステム全体の成長にも貢献しています。
ソラナDApps開発の課題と解決策
ソラナは多くのメリットを持つ一方で、DApps開発にはいくつかの課題も存在します。
- Rustプログラミング言語の習得:ソラナのスマートコントラクトはRustで記述されるため、Rustの知識が必要です。
- セキュリティリスク:スマートコントラクトの脆弱性は、資金の損失につながる可能性があります。
- ネットワークの安定性:ソラナは、過去にネットワークの停止や遅延が発生したことがあります。
- スケーラビリティ:トランザクション量の増加に対応するためのスケーラビリティの向上が課題です。
これらの課題に対して、ソラナコミュニティは様々な解決策に取り組んでいます。
- 開発ツールの改善:Rustの学習を支援するツールや、スマートコントラクトの開発を容易にするフレームワークが開発されています。
- セキュリティ監査の実施:スマートコントラクトのセキュリティ監査を専門とする企業が登場し、脆弱性の発見と修正を支援しています。
- ネットワークの最適化:ネットワークの安定性を向上させるためのアップデートや、スケーラビリティを向上させるための技術開発が進められています。
ソラナDAppsの今後の展望
ソラナは、その高性能と低手数料により、DAppsの基盤としてますます重要な役割を果たすと考えられます。今後の展望としては、以下の点が挙げられます。
- DeFiのさらなる発展:より複雑な金融商品やサービスを提供するDeFiアプリケーションが登場し、従来の金融システムに挑戦する可能性があります。
- NFTの多様化:アート、ゲーム、音楽など、様々な分野でNFTの活用が進み、新たなビジネスモデルが生まれる可能性があります。
- ゲームの進化:ブロックチェーンゲームのグラフィックやゲームプレイが向上し、より多くのユーザーを魅了する可能性があります。
- Web3インフラの強化:より安全で使いやすいウォレットや、異なるブロックチェーン間の相互運用性を高めるブリッジが登場し、Web3エコシステムの発展を促進する可能性があります。
- 企業との連携:大手企業がソラナを採用し、新たなサービスやアプリケーションを開発する可能性があります。
また、ソラナは、モバイルデバイスとの連携を強化し、より多くのユーザーがDAppsを利用できるようにするための取り組みを進めています。さらに、ソラナは、環境負荷を低減するための取り組みも行っており、持続可能なブロックチェーンプラットフォームとしての地位を確立することを目指しています。
結論
ソラナは、その革新的な技術と活発なコミュニティにより、DAppsの分野で急速に成長しています。DeFi、NFT、ゲームなど、様々なカテゴリーのDAppsがソラナ上で展開されており、従来のWeb2サービスに代わる新たな選択肢を提供しています。DApps開発にはいくつかの課題も存在しますが、ソラナコミュニティは、これらの課題を克服するための努力を続けています。今後、ソラナは、DAppsの基盤としてますます重要な役割を果たし、Web3エコシステムの発展に大きく貢献することが期待されます。ソラナの技術革新とエコシステムの成長は、ブロックチェーン技術の可能性を広げ、私たちの生活をより豊かにするでしょう。